E-levy will be a problem if the lives of Ghanaians are not improved as promised- Prince David Osei
Ghanaian actor, Prince David Osei has expressed his concerns about the implementation of tax on mobile electronic transactions (e-levy) and if the government will put the monies into good use.
The actor, who is also a staunch supporter of the New Patriotic Party (NPP) expressed that although a large section of Ghanaians are kicking against e-levy, he thinks the government’s goal to direct the monies towards nation-building is a good thing.
Speaking in an interview with Ameyaw TV on the red carpet of the recently held Vodafone Ghana Music Awards (VGMAs) Prince stated that he was hoping the collection of said taxes will be used in improving the lives of Ghanaians.
“All I’m saying is, whatever tariffs, whatever monies they’re taking, I just pray we put it in better use. Let us see the effect on the lives of the people, let’s see the effect in our economy, its not about taking all the monies and at the end of the day the standard of living is still the same,” he stated.
He also explained that the whole global economy is in crisis, and so “if we are asking people to pay more, we need to see improvements in their lives.”
